Freddie Freeman's Homer Helps Dodgers Down Braves

Freeman hit a 413-foot homer and Ohtani drove in the go-ahead run as Los Angeles won behind a strong bullpen effort.

  • On Friday, the Los Angeles Dodgers defeated the Atlanta Braves 3-1 in a National League division leaders showdown, with Freddie Freeman, Kyle Tucker, and Shohei Ohtani each driving in runs.
  • Emmet Sheehan limited Atlanta to one run over 4 innings, outperforming Chris Sale, whom the Braves pay $18 million while the Dodgers pay Sheehan less than $1 million this season.
  • Freeman connected for his 100th home run as a Dodger, a 413-foot shot to center field in the sixth inning, ending a 25-game drought for the All-Star.
  • Alex Vesia earned the win in relief while Tanner Scott pitched a perfect ninth inning for his third save, marking the Braves' eighth consecutive defeat at Dodger Stadium.
  • The Dodgers plan to activate Blake Snell from the injured list Saturday to start against Atlanta, while also hoping to return shortstop Mookie Betts from the injured list Monday.
